function rePos(el,id,dx,dy){
var ido6 = navigator.appVersion.indexOf('MSIE 6.0');
var ido7 = navigator.appVersion.indexOf('MSIE 7.0');
var ido8 = navigator.appVersion.indexOf('Trident');
if((ido6!=-1)&&(ido7==-1)&&(ido8==-1)){ie6=true;}else{ie6=false;}
if((ido7!=-1)&&(ido6==-1)&&(ido8==-1)){ie7=true;}else{ie7=false;}
if(ido8!=-1){ie8=true;}else{ie8=false;}
var ied=0;
if(ie7||ie8){
ied=-220;
}
var scrollPos;
if (typeof window.pageYOffset != 'undefined') {
scrollPos = window.pageYOffset;
}
else if (typeof document.compatMode != 'undefined' &&
document.compatMode != 'BackCompat') {
scrollPos = document.documentElement.scrollTop;
}
else if (typeof document.body != 'undefined') {
scrollPos = document.body.scrollTop;
}
el = document.getElementById(el);
if(false){
alert(errorMsg);
}else{
for (var lx=0, ly=0; el!=null;lx+=el.offsetLeft,ly+=el.offsetTop,el=el.offsetParent);
document.getElementById(id).style.top = (ly+dy+ied-scrollPos)+"px"; 
document.getElementById(id).style.left=parseInt(document.getElementById(id).style.left)+"px";
}
}

